Things you should know about short-term car lease

Oct 18, 2024 By Rick Novak

Leasing a car for 6 months 2 years is known as a short-term car lease, which will allow you to lease a car for a short duration. It's not like a traditional long-term leasing in which you need to lease a car for a longer duration. Such a sort of lease is effective if you want to lease a car for a shorter period like a job assignment. 

If you don't have enough money or don't want to buy a vehicle, a short-term care lease would be a good idea. With it you can explore new places without huge investment or commitment. But remember, you have to pay more contract tax than a car lease's longer duration.

What should I know before I lease a car?

Before you lease a car, you have to understand what leasing is. It is renting a car for a short duration; after the lease period ends, you have to return the car and walk away, and you don't own it. Read the necessary details of the agreement, including all the necessary details like cost, a termination fee, or next-time purchase option. 

Understand the type of car you want and how much money you have. There is sometimes a limit for mileage, like 12,000-15,000 miles. Over that mileage, you have to pay on per mile base. Just like you, the car leases are also negotiable. Be ready for negotiation on money factors, which can influence the interest rate.

How to get a short term car lease

Here are the steps to get a car on lease for the short term:

  1. Visit dealerships: Check out local dealerships to understand terms and conditions for short-lease to get an idea of the market. 
  2. Know your budget: You have to make on-time payments monthly; make sure you have strong credits because dealers want to know clearly whether you can make payments effortlessly!
  3. Apply for lease: Once you have found the car that meets your requirements, it's time to submit your application.
  4. Put a security deposit: In most cases, you must pay a security deposit before renting a car. The security is refundable and will be returned to you at the end of the lease if the vehicle is fine without any damage.
  5. Pay fees: At the start of the lease, you must pay some fees like registration to register in your state. 

Is short term car lease is a good idea?

It's a good idea to have a car on a short-term lease, as it offers flexibility and convenience. But it's not the ultimate solution; you must consider its mileage limitations and high costs. Here are the pros and cons that will help you to make a decision:

Pros of short term car lease

The advantages of short-term car leases are:

  • No serious Investment: Without making any serious car, you can drive the car and fulfill your needs. You don't need to buy a new car; just lease a car for a short duration and get things done. But use it with care; otherwise, you have to pay for any damage to the car.
  • Enjoy a new car: Ride the latest model of your favorite car and swap it for the next one with new features after the lease ends. Short-term car leases help you upgrade to new modes faster than long-term ones.
  • Predictable Budget: With short-term, you can make payments monthly. This will help you make a better budget for fuel, fees, and other expenditures. 
  • Low Commitment: You can get a car with low commitment to do your temporary job. You can even test your favorite car to get an idea of whether it meets your lifestyle. A short-term car lease will help to make a final decision on whether it is worth investing or not.
  • Convenience: In the lease agreement, a short-term car lease includes roadside assistance and maintenance, just like renting a car. If you don't like car maintenance, this is a plus point for you. 

Cons of short term lease

The disadvantages of getting a car on a short-term lease are:

  • More costly than a traditional lease: You can expect large monthly payments on a short-term lease compared to a traditional lease. It's because of the depreciation factor that is mentioned in the lease agreement. 
  • Limited mileage: There is a mileage limit when you have a car on short term. You must follow this mileage limit. Otherwise, you have to pay additional payment when the lease contract ends. 
  • Difficult to find: Only a few rental or car dealership companies offer such a lease deal because it's less popular than traditional leases.
